General Rules
In Surfside, CA, permits are often required for garage door work involving new installations, structural changes, or electrical components like openers.
Minor repairs usually don't need one, but rules can vary by project scope.
When Permits Are Required
Typically required for:
- New garage door installations
- Replacing doors of different sizes or types
- Installing or replacing electric openers
- Any structural modifications
Verify with Surfside building officials.
Common Exemptions
Often exempt:
- Lubrication, painting, or minor adjustments
- Replacing parts like springs or rollers (no structural change)
- Like-for-like repairs
Still, confirm locally.

Permit Process
1. Check Requirements
Review your project and contact Surfside building department or their website to see if a permit is needed.
2. Submit Application
Prepare plans, contractor details, and photos. Apply online, by mail, or in person.
3. Pay Fees & Get Approval
Submit fees (varies by project). Approval may take days to weeks.
4. Start Work & Inspections
Begin after approval. Schedule inspections to confirm code compliance.

Special Considerations
HOA Rules
Surfside has many HOAs. Get HOA approval for visible exterior changes like garage doors, even without a city permit.
Zoning
Ensure door complies with zoning for size, color, and setbacks. Contact planning department.
Historic Properties
If in a historic area, additional reviews may apply for aesthetic changes. Check property status.
